Cell Adhesion Molecules
Proteins located on the cell surface involved in binding with other cells or with the extracellular matrix in the process of cell adhesion.
Tropic Molecules
Guidance molecules that direct the growth of developing neurons towards or away from certain areas during neural development.
Subventricular Zone
A layer of brain tissue where neural stem cells are located, playing a role in the generation of new neurons during adulthood.
